Someone brought up some good questions on the Superteamer's channel and I thought they deserved to be repeated here.
Sprint is allowed
So is secondary mutation. If someone does get increased movement speed, it's only 15%. I don't see that as a significant advantage.
It was also asked if you had to be level 1 when you finished the race. I suppose it is possible for a blaster to get enough xp by killing a mob. Personally, I would be impressed if someone did manage to level. However, the challenge of this race is to do it at level 1. I would also consider the tier 3 inspiration bonus from leveling to be a unfair advantage. So you have to start as a level 1 and finish as a level 1.
Return to battle will also not be allowed because the level up bonus would be an unfair advantage.
Mystic Fortune will also not be allowed because the fool offers a significant movement speed increase.
The commuter day job is also allowed. It only offers a 10% run speed buff. Not a huge advantage.
